JOB SUMMARY

The purpose of this position is to provide real-time technical support to the Operations Teams and other support staff assigned. The individual is responsible for providing Operations Teams and Supervisors with the necessary information to produce products that meet PCBs food safety and quality standards at the lowest cost in a timely manner. The individual plays a key role in assisting in the identification, investigation, and follow up activities of PCB continuous improvement program. Support, implement, and maintain food safety practices as required through SQF. Will be responsible for completing job duties in a manner that supports all plant safety, food safety, quality, and environmental practices.

ACTIVITIES/DUTIES

  1. Provide Operations Team Members, management, and Maintenance with technical resources in areas of product quality and food safety during on-going production, as well as in noncompliance situations. Attend noncompliance meetings to give direction on immediate actions, root cause investigation, product disposition, and any necessary corrective actions.
  2. Perform audits and analyses on finished and intermediate products, ingredients, packaging, and systems and follow safety, sanitation, Good Manufacturing Practices, and Good Laboratory Practices while performing tests
  3. Conduct investigations into consumer and customer complaints.
  4. Perform, record and report audit findings in areas of Pest Prevention, Sanitation, GMP’s, Pre-Op Inspection/Testing, Plant Environment, HACCP, SSOP’s, Net Weight, PSAs, Metal Detection Audit, Documentation Audit, Allergen Testing, and Ingredient COA Verification.
  5. Calibration and maintenance of Quality measurement equipment in production and in the QA Lab.
  6. Provide information and data to support the QA group in assigned project areas.
  7. Use databases to hold and release product, provide non-compliance ingredient and packaging information to vendors (SCAR’s), and report and store audit reports.
  8. Utilize the Quality Department resources to help in the identification and resolution of issues.
  9. Additional duties as required by Management to meet the food-safety needs of the facility.
